Job Description

JOB SUMMARY

 

The Sales Analyst role involves providing meticulous account management to Wheatland customers by analyzing their expectations and collaborating with internal teams for streamlined communication. The position requires a proactive approach to maximize efficiency and ensure alignment with customer expectations. Ideal candidates possess strong analytical skills, a background in sales analysis, and a commitment to fostering positive relationships with both customers and internal stakeholders.
